A 70 year old Oudtshoorn man has been arrested for allegedly stabbing a 13-year-old girl.
Police spokesperson, captain Bernadine Steyn, says the incident happened on Saturday night when the girl was leaving a game centre in Bridgton, to go home.
She says the man stabbed the girl several times.
"As she was leaving the suspect took hold of her and allegedly stabbed her with a knife. She sustained an open wound in her chest, shoulder, back and neck. Two girls who were passing by assisted the victim after which she was able to flee the scene. Shortly after the incident the suspect was arrested. He will appear in court on Monday" she said.
